Man arraigned for strangling two-month-old baby

A Magistrate Court in Kano on Monday remanded a 32-year-old businessman, Kamal Rabiu, in prison for allegedly strangling a two-month old baby, the News Agency of Nigeria reported.

Chief Magistrate Muhammad Idris ordered the remand of the accused, who was charged with culpable homicide, following an application by the Police prosecutor, Inspector Badamasi Ya’u.

He said the accused should remain behind bars pending an advice from the state Director of Public Prosecution.

Ya’u had told the court sitting in Nomans Land, Kano that on December 21, 2015, the Commander of Hisba, Kano command, reported the case to the Commissioner of Police.

He said the accused of Goron Dutse Quarters, Kano, had sometime in February 15, 2015, impregnated his female friend, Malama Kaltume Tijjani of Unguwa Uku Kano, who eventually gave birth to a baby boy named Muhammad Kamal.

Ya’u told the court that on December 21, 2015, the accused went to Nasarawa Hospital to collect the two month-old Kamal from Kaltume.

“In a struggle that ensued, Rabiu strangled the baby,” the police prosecutor said.

The accused, however, pleaded not guilty to the charge.

The Magistrate adjourned the case till Feb. 8, for further mention.
